How do you address non-adherence to medical treatment in adolescent and young adult oncology patients due to mental illness such as depression?
Answer from: at Community Practice
The best answer, I think, is to obtain a thorough child psychiatric evaluation. Noncompliance may arise from a number of different issues, some of which may relate to major mental illnesses such as major depression or anxiety disorders, or more cognitively based concerns such as ADHD or executive fu...
After a good evaluation to ensure that the diagnosis is correct (e.g., unipolar versus bipolar depression, possible role of substance use disorder), treat the mood disorder accordingly.
A good, trusting relationship with the provider and other members of the treatment team is also essential.
